New Jersey Statutes, Title: 17, CORPORATIONS AND INSTITUTIONS FOR FINANCE AND INSURANCE
Chapter 24: Investments by insurance companies generally.
Section: 17:24-6: Marine insurance companies; additional investments
Any company organized for the purpose of marine insurance may also lend its funds on bottomry and respondentia bonds and change and reinvest the same.
